About the Role

The Japan Brand Marketing team plays a critical role when it comes to establishing deep connections with consumers representing the frontline of our business. They work closely with business stakeholders (Comms, Policy, Ops, S&P, R&I, Data Science, and Legal and CommOps) as well as external stakeholders (agency partners) to bring our products and brand to life in the market.

They're empowered and responsible to assist and deliver brand campaigns from strategy and brief through to execution and measurement ensuring everything is delivered as expected, on time and on budget. Our Marketing Manager will be involved in the development and execution of the annual marketing plans, leading end-to-end projects for Japan Marketing - from conceptualization, ideation, executiion and performance evaluation.

Basic Qualification:
  1. Brand Strategy and Creative Experience (mandatory): Working alongside the Senior Marketing Manager, you'll collaborate with the internal and agency teams to deliver strategic and creative marketing campaigns and projects that consumers care about.
  2. Marketing and Business Acumen: Using a deep understanding of the business priorities, the macro and micro factors impacting us and the global business, you'll ensure all campaigns and projects throughout the full marketing funnel are driving positive impact and are sufficiently evaluated taking on board key learnings.
  3. Collaboration: You'll work collaboratively with partners, internal stakeholders and agencies to maximize the impact of your work. Be renown for nurturing a culture of collaboration, be someone that inspires, motivates and clearly communicates to unite them to deliver the best work.
  4. Project Management: Manage multiple work streams, work under pressure to deadlines, own decisions, manage big budgets and communicate clearly at every level through the business.
  5. Good Balance Between Creative & Data-Driven Mindsets: You care about the number and what the data is saying, but you also can dig deeper into the creative and visionary side of what makes a successful marketing campaign.

Preferred Qualifications
  1. Strong business acumen; you'll be a structured thinker with project management skills and attention to detail. You'll be able to work to tight deadlines at a fast pace and be capable of juggling several projects simultaneously. You'll also have the ability to take the initiative in a constantly-changing work environment with a willingness to adopt a generalist mindset.
  2. Self-motivated and proactive, taking the initiative to pre-empt problems or opportunities while still being a team player that believes by working together, we'll achieve greater success.
  3. A clear, confident and concise communicator with good relationship management, including strong written communication skills and the ability to bring to life the Uber brand in a way that is both consistent with our global brand positioning but also meaningful to local culture and customs.
  4. A strong customer-centric mindset - you are always thinking about how our customers interact with the brand.
  5. Fluency in Japanese. Buisness level English.
